NTSB Narrative Summary Released at Completion of Accident

WHILE STILL SEVERAL MILES FROM ADDISON, TX, THE ACFT ENCOUNTERED THE LEADING EDGE OF A THUNDERSTORM. BOTH OCCUPANTS STATED THE ACFT ENCOUNTERED WIND SHEAR. REPORTEDLY, THE WIND SHEAR WAS SO SEVERE THAT IT FORCED THE ACFT DOWN & IT CONTACTED THE GROUND. A FEW MINUTES PRIOR TO THE ACCIDENT, THE WX AT ADDISON CHANGED FROM 1300 SCATTERED TO 900 FT OBSCURED, VISIBILITY 1 MI. ABOUT 30 MIN LATER, THE WX IMPROVED SIGNIFICANTLY.
